Dolphins face threats from various predators and environmental challenges. Natural predators include orcas (killer whales), which are known to hunt dolphins. Additionally, human activities pose significant risks, such as fishing nets, pollution, and habitat destruction, which can lead to injuries or fatalities for these marine mammals. Climate change also affects their food sources and habitats, further endangering their survival.
